Vitamin C serums are among the most effective of skincare products that can be added to your skincare routine for targeting a plethora of common concerns in one hit. Vitamin C is a potent antioxidant which keeps inflammation at bay and interferes with pigment production, making it one of the best ingredients for brightening. These antioxidant properties also make the best vitamin C serums well equipped to fight pollution and the other aggressors your complexion is faced with every day. If that wasn’t enough, vitamin C serums can help with fine lines, dryness, dark spots and hyperpigmentation. Whew. 

Basically, there’s a damn good reason why vitamin C is the most searched-for skincare ingredient of all time (according to data analysed by Cult Beauty), and though vitamin C products like moisturisers and toners are available to shop, it’s one of the best vitamin C serums that will enable your skin to benefit from a potent and concentrated injection of it.

Can I use vitamin C serum everyday?

Yes, you can. In fact, it’s advised. When you use your vitamin C face serum on a daily basis, you can expect to see a brightening of your skin texture and a reduction in acne scars. Skin looks glowy, dark circles appear reduced and your complexion will be protected from pollution. Just make sure you select the best formulation for your skin type (more on that below). 

As for where the vitamin C serums fit into your existing skincare regime? You’ll want to apply it after cleansing to clean and dry skin, in the morning and at night (or just in the morning, depending on the form of vitamin C and potency you choose). Follow your vitamin C serum with your favourite moisturiser and face sunscreen or SPF during the day, and a night cream in the evening. This will seal the serum and hydrate your complexion further. 

Who should not use vitamin C serum?

There are a few skin types which might wish to steer clear. Case in point: those with rosacea. Using a vitamin C serum may cause unwanted irritation.
